Transaction fd28768c950e4bf0dfd70f754d60ceb35f90348fac52ae7878616ed84b14f39e
2 Input
1 Outputs
- fd28768c950e4bf0dfd70f754d60ceb35f90348fac52ae7878616ed84b14f39e:0
value 6387864
address 1Ly3RRZnvUELAFuomcRr7n7Rz3rnVn6t9C